Certificate in Company Culture
Company culture refers to the shared values, beliefs, attitudes, and
behaviors that characterize an organization and guide how its employees
interact with each other and with external stakeholders. It encompasses
the overall environment and atmosphere within the workplace, including
norms, rituals, communication styles, and management practices. A strong
company culture aligns employees with the organization's mission,
vision, and goals, fostering a sense of belonging, engagement, and
mutual respect among team members.
Why is Company Culture important?
- Employee Engagement and Retention: A positive company culture contributes to higher levels of employee engagement, satisfaction, and retention by creating a supportive and inclusive work environment.
- Performance and Productivity: Company culture influences employee motivation, morale, and commitment, impacting individual and team performance, productivity, and overall organizational success.
- Talent Attraction and Recruitment: A strong company culture attracts top talent and enhances employer branding, making the organization more appealing to prospective employees and candidates.
- Innovation and Creativity: Company culture that encourages risk-taking, experimentation, and open communication fosters innovation, creativity, and continuous improvement within the organization.
- Organizational Values and Ethics: Company culture reflects and reinforces the organization's values, ethics, and principles, guiding decision-making and behavior at all levels of the organization.
